| Adams denies Brentford link |

Tony Adams has denied that he has applied for the manager's job at Brentford.
Steve Coppell resigned from the post after taking the club to the second division play-off final last season. Earlier today
there were reports that Adams had applied for the job, and had been turned down by chairman Ron Noades (who is said to be close to appointing former Wimbledon player Wally Downes).
The stories prompted the Arsenal skipper to ring the Evening
Standard to deny it.
Adams has just come back from a break in the south of France,
and the Standard speculate that he is to announce his retirement
this season, but will stay at Arsenal in a coaching role.
